Typographical Conventions
In order to help you use this manual with the remote control, front-panel controls and rear-panel con-
nections, certain conventions have been used.
EXAMPLE – (bold type) indicates a specific remote control or front-panel button, or rear-panel 
connection jack
EXAMPLE
– (OCR type) indicates a message that is visible on the front-panel information display 
EXAMPLE
– (Synchro type) indicates a message that is displayed on the remote control’s LCD screen
1 –  (number in a square) indicates a specific front-panel control
 –  (number in a circle) indicates a rear-panel connection
0 – (number in an oval) indicates a button or indicator on the remote
å – (letter in an oval) indicates a button on the Zone II remote
